The atmosphere is the layer of gases that surrounds the Earth. It is made up of several gases, including nitrogen, oxygen, carbon dioxide, and others. The atmosphere plays a vital role in supporting life by providing the air we breathe, protecting us from harmful rays of the sun (like UV rays), and helping to maintain the Earth’s temperature through the greenhouse effect.The atmosphere is divided into different layers: the troposphere, stratosphere, mesosphere, thermosphere, and exosphere. Each layer has its own characteristics and functions.Protecting the atmosphere is important for our health and the environment. We can help by reducing pollution, conserving energy, and supporting eco-friendly practices.
